Source-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[src/trunk]: src/usr.sbin/sysinst Make sure all menus have a translatable exi...



details:   https://anonhg.NetBSD.org/src/rev/aae59ce6e835
branches:  trunk
changeset: 846447:aae59ce6e835
user:      martin <martin%NetBSD.org@localhost>
date:      Sat Nov 16 20:26:59 2019 +0000

description:
Make sure all menus have a translatable exit option (or none at all).

diffstat:

 usr.sbin/sysinst/configmenu.c |   4 ++--
 usr.sbin/sysinst/disks.c      |   9 ++++-----
 usr.sbin/sysinst/msg.mi.de    |   4 +++-
 usr.sbin/sysinst/msg.mi.en    |   5 +++--
 usr.sbin/sysinst/msg.mi.es    |   4 +++-
 usr.sbin/sysinst/msg.mi.fr    |   4 +++-
 usr.sbin/sysinst/msg.mi.pl    |   4 +++-
 usr.sbin/sysinst/net.c        |   4 ++--
 usr.sbin/sysinst/partman.c    |  21 ++++++++++++---------
 usr.sbin/sysinst/run.c        |   4 ++--
 usr.sbin/sysinst/util.c       |   5 +++--
 11 files changed, 40 insertions(+), 28 deletions(-)

diffs (252 lines):

di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/configmenu.c
--- a/usr.sbin/sysinst/configmenu.c     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/configmenu.c     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/* $NetBSD: configmenu.c,v 1.10 2019/07/23 18:13:40 martin Exp $ */
+/* $NetBSD: configmenu.c,v 1.11 2019/11/16 20:26:59 martin Exp $ */
 
 /*-
  * Copyright (c) 2012 The NetBSD Foundation, Inc.
@@ -464,7 +464,7 @@
 
        menu_no = new_menu(NULL, me, opts, 0, -4, 0, 70,
                MC_SCROLL | MC_NOBOX | MC_DFLTEXIT,
-               configmenu_hdr, set_config, NULL, "XXX Help String",
+               configmenu_hdr, set_config, NULL, NULL,
                MSG_doneconfig);
 
        process_menu(menu_no, ce);
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/disks.c
--- a/usr.sbin/sysinst/disks.c  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/disks.c  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: disks.c,v 1.56 2019/11/13 18:57:26 martin Exp $ */
+/*     $NetBSD: disks.c,v 1.57 2019/11/16 20:26:59 martin Exp $ */
 
 /*
  * Copyright 1997 Piermont Information Systems Inc.
@@ -852,7 +852,7 @@
                        menu_no = new_menu(MSG_Available_disks,
                                dsk_menu, i, -1,
                                 4, 0, 0, MC_SCROLL,
-                               NULL, NULL, NULL, NULL, NULL);
+                               NULL, NULL, NULL, NULL, MSG_exit_menu_generic);
                        if (menu_no == -1)
                                return -1;
                        msg_fmt_display(MSG_ask_disk, "%s", doingwhat);
@@ -2211,7 +2211,7 @@
            3, 3, 0, 60,
            MC_SUBMENU | MC_SCROLL | MC_NOCLEAR,
            NULL, display_single_part, NULL,
-           NULL, NULL);
+           NULL, MSG_exit_menu_generic);
        if (sel_menu != -1) {
                struct selected_partition *newsels;
                struct sel_menu_data data;
@@ -2410,8 +2410,7 @@
        /* loop with menu */
        update_sel_part_title(&data);
        m = new_menu(data.title, men, __arraycount(men), 3, 2, 0, 65, MC_SCROLL,
-           post_sel_part, fmt_sel_part_line, NULL, NULL,
-           "Source selection OK, proceed to target selection");
+           post_sel_part, fmt_sel_part_line, NULL, NULL, MSG_clone_src_done);
        process_menu(m, &data);
        free(data.title);
        if (res->num_sel == 0)
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/msg.mi.de
--- a/usr.sbin/sysinst/msg.mi.de        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/msg.mi.de        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: msg.mi.de,v 1.17 2019/11/12 16:33:14 martin Exp $      */
+/*     $NetBSD: msg.mi.de,v 1.18 2019/11/16 20:26:59 martin Exp $      */
 
 /*
  * Copyright 1997 Piermont Information Systems Inc.
@@ -1498,3 +1498,5 @@
 message clone_target_hdr
 {Einfügen der duplizierten Partitionen vor:}
 message clone_target_disp              {duplizierte Partition(en)}
+message clone_src_done
+{Quellselektion OK, weiter mit der Zielauswahl}
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/msg.mi.en
--- a/usr.sbin/sysinst/msg.mi.en        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/msg.mi.en        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: msg.mi.en,v 1.24 2019/11/12 16:33:14 martin Exp $      */
+/*     $NetBSD: msg.mi.en,v 1.25 2019/11/16 20:26:59 martin Exp $      */
 
 /*
  * Copyright 1997 Piermont Information Systems Inc.
@@ -1438,4 +1438,5 @@
 message clone_target_hdr
 {Insert cloned partitions before:}
 message clone_target_disp              {cloned partition(s)}
-
+message clone_src_done
+{Source selection OK, proceed to target selection}
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/msg.mi.es
--- a/usr.sbin/sysinst/msg.mi.es        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/msg.mi.es        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: msg.mi.es,v 1.18 2019/11/12 16:33:14 martin Exp $      */
+/*     $NetBSD: msg.mi.es,v 1.19 2019/11/16 20:26:59 martin Exp $      */
 
 /*
  * Copyright 1997 Piermont Information Systems Inc.
@@ -1486,4 +1486,6 @@
 message clone_target_hdr
 {Insert cloned partitions before:}
 message clone_target_disp              {cloned partition(s)}
+message clone_src_done
+{Source selection OK, proceed to target selection}
 
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/msg.mi.fr
--- a/usr.sbin/sysinst/msg.mi.fr        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/msg.mi.fr        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: msg.mi.fr,v 1.22 2019/11/12 16:33:14 martin Exp $      */
+/*     $NetBSD: msg.mi.fr,v 1.23 2019/11/16 20:26:59 martin Exp $      */
 
 /*
  * Copyright 1997 Piermont Information Systems Inc.
@@ -1530,4 +1530,6 @@
 message clone_target_hdr
 {Insert cloned partitions before:}
 message clone_target_disp              {cloned partition(s)}
+message clone_src_done
+{Source selection OK, proceed to target selection}
 
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/msg.mi.pl
--- a/usr.sbin/sysinst/msg.mi.pl        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/msg.mi.pl        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: msg.mi.pl,v 1.25 2019/11/12 16:33:14 martin Exp $      */
+/*     $NetBSD: msg.mi.pl,v 1.26 2019/11/16 20:26:59 martin Exp $      */
 /*     Based on english version: */
 /*     NetBSD: msg.mi.pl,v 1.36 2004/04/17 18:55:35 atatat Exp       */
 
@@ -1425,4 +1425,6 @@
 message clone_target_hdr
 {Insert cloned partitions before:}
 message clone_target_disp              {cloned partition(s)}
+message clone_src_done
+{Source selection OK, proceed to target selection}
 
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/net.c
--- a/usr.sbin/sysinst/net.c    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/net.c    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: net.c,v 1.33 2019/07/23 12:37:23 martin Exp $  */
+/*     $NetBSD: net.c,v 1.34 2019/11/16 20:26:59 martin Exp $  */
 
 /*
  * Copyright 1997 Piermont Information Systems Inc.
@@ -524,7 +524,7 @@
        menu_no = new_menu(MSG_netdevs,
                net_menu, num_devs, -1, 4, 0, 0,
                MC_SCROLL,
-               NULL, NULL, NULL, NULL, NULL);
+               NULL, NULL, NULL, NULL, MSG_cancel);
 again:
        selected_net = -1;
        msg_display(MSG_asknetdev);
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/partman.c
--- a/usr.sbin/sysinst/partman.c        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/partman.c        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: partman.c,v 1.43 2019/10/06 00:05:10 mrg Exp $ */
+/*     $NetBSD: partman.c,v 1.44 2019/11/16 20:26:59 martin Exp $ */
 
 /*
  * Copyright 2012 Eugene Lozovoy
@@ -387,8 +387,9 @@
                }
 
        menu_no = new_menu(MSG_avdisks,
-               menu_entries, num_devs, -1, -1, (num_devs+1<3)?3:num_devs+1, 13,
-               MC_SCROLL | MC_NOCLEAR, NULL, NULL, NULL, NULL, NULL);
+               menu_entries, num_devs, -1, -1,
+               (num_devs+1<3)?3:num_devs+1, 13,
+               MC_SCROLL | MC_NOCLEAR, NULL, NULL, NULL, NULL, MSG_cancel);
        if (menu_no == -1)
                return (struct part_entry) { .retvalue = -1, };
        process_menu(menu_no, &dev_num);
@@ -589,7 +590,7 @@
                menu_disk_adddel = new_menu(NULL, menuent_disk_adddel, 
                        __arraycount(menuent_disk_adddel),
                        -1, -1, 0, 10, MC_NOCLEAR, NULL, NULL, NULL, NULL,
-                       NULL);
+                       MSG_cancel);
        }
        
        switch (m->cursel) {
@@ -762,8 +763,9 @@
        }
 
        menu_no = new_menu(MSG_raid_disks,
-               menu_entries, num_devs, -1, -1, (num_devs+1<3)?3:num_devs+1, 13,
-               MC_SCROLL | MC_NOCLEAR, NULL, NULL, NULL, NULL, NULL);
+               menu_entries, num_devs, -1, -1,
+               (num_devs+1<3)?3:num_devs+1, 13,
+               MC_SCROLL | MC_NOCLEAR, NULL, NULL, NULL, NULL, MSG_cancel);
        if (menu_no == -1)
                return -1;
        process_menu(menu_no, &retvalue);
@@ -1493,8 +1495,9 @@
        }
 
        menu_no = new_menu(MSG_lvm_disks,
-               menu_entries, num_devs, -1, -1, (num_devs+1<3)?3:num_devs+1, 13,
-               MC_SCROLL | MC_NOCLEAR, NULL, NULL, NULL, NULL, NULL);
+               menu_entries, num_devs, -1, -1,
+               (num_devs+1<3)?3:num_devs+1, 13,
+               MC_SCROLL | MC_NOCLEAR, NULL, NULL, NULL, NULL, MSG_cancel);
        if (menu_no == -1)
                return -1;
        process_menu(menu_no, &retvalue);
@@ -1607,7 +1610,7 @@
                menu_disk_adddel = new_menu(NULL, menuent_disk_adddel,
                        __arraycount(menuent_disk_adddel),
                        -1, -1, 0, 10, MC_NOCLEAR, NULL, NULL, NULL, NULL,
-                       NULL);
+                       MSG_cancel);
        }
 
        switch (m->cursel) {
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/run.c
--- a/usr.sbin/sysinst/run.c    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/run.c    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: run.c,v 1.12 2019/06/22 20:46:07 christos Exp $        */
+/*     $NetBSD: run.c,v 1.13 2019/11/16 20:26:59 martin Exp $  */
 
 /*
  * Copyright 1997 Piermont Information Systems Inc.
@@ -99,7 +99,7 @@
 
        menu_no = new_menu(MSG_Logging_functions, logmenu, 2, -1, 12,
                0, 20, MC_SCROLL, NULL, log_menu_label, NULL,
-               MSG_Pick_an_option, NULL);
+               MSG_Pick_an_option, MSG_exit_menu_generic);
 
        if (menu_no < 0) {
                (void)fprintf(stderr, "Dynamic menu creation failed.\n");
diff -r ef93c6d289e8 -r aae59ce6e835 usr.sbin/sysinst/util.c
--- a/usr.sbin/sysinst/util.c   Sat Nov 16 19:23:56 2019 +0000
+++ b/usr.sbin/sysinst/util.c   Sat Nov 16 20:26:59 2019 +0000
@@ -1,4 +1,4 @@
-/*     $NetBSD: util.c,v 1.38 2019/11/14 13:58:22 martin Exp $ */
+/*     $NetBSD: util.c,v 1.39 2019/11/16 20:26:59 martin Exp $ */
 
 /*
  * Copyright 1997 Piermont Information Systems Inc.
@@ -1467,7 +1467,8 @@
        menu_no = new_menu(NULL, NULL, 14, 23, 9,
                           12, 32, MC_ALWAYS_SCROLL | MC_NOSHORTCUT,
                           tzm_set_names, NULL, NULL,
-                          "\nPlease consult the install documents.", NULL);
+                          "\nPlease consult the install documents.",
+                          MSG_exit_menu_generic);
        if (menu_no < 0)
                goto done;      /* error - skip timezone setting */
 



Home | Main Index | Thread Index | Old Index